Premium Sedan vs. SUV: Comparing Costs
For those interested in premium sedans, the average cost in 2027 is estimated to hover around $40 to $50 USD per hour. These vehicles typically come with amenities such as leather seats, air conditioning, and professional drivers knowledgeable about Bali’s routes and landmarks. The appeal of a premium sedan lies in its smooth ride and the ability to navigate narrow roads with ease, making it a preferred choice for individuals or couples.
In contrast, SUVs are priced slightly higher, averaging between $60 to $70 USD per hour. The increased cost is justified by their larger seating capacity and capability to traverse Bali’s rugged landscapes. SUVs are popular among families and larger groups who require more space for passengers and luggage. These vehicles also provide an elevated vantage point, offering enhanced views of Bali’s scenic routes.
Travelers opting for SUVs may find them particularly useful for trips to more remote or rugged areas of Bali, such as the mountainous region of Kintamani or the picturesque lakeside village of Bedugul. The added space and power of SUVs make them suitable for journeys that involve off-the-beaten-path adventures, where road conditions can be less predictable.
Seasonal Variations in Transport Costs
The cost of luxury transport in Bali can fluctuate based on the season. The island’s peak tourist season, which includes the months of July and August, often sees a surge in prices due to increased demand. During these times, securing a vehicle may require advance booking due to high occupancy rates. Conversely, the months leading up to June, including the Balimindfulness retreat period, are considered shoulder seasons. Travelers during this time can often find more competitive pricing and greater availability of luxury transport services.
Weather conditions can also impact transport costs. Bali’s dry season, from April to October, is generally more favorable for travel, which can lead to a steady demand for luxury vehicles. The rainy season, from November to March, might see a dip in prices as fewer tourists visit the island, offering potential savings for those who choose to travel during this period.
Bali’s tropical climate means that the weather is relatively consistent year-round, with slight variations in humidity and rainfall. During the dry season, transportation may be more reliable, and scenic routes, such as those through the rice paddies of Jatiluwih, are more accessible. In contrast, during the rainy season, travelers might encounter occasional delays or need to adjust their plans to accommodate changing weather conditions.
